Fråga
Jag har fått ett problem med en Windows 10-klient och nätverk efter en uppdatering. Först en specifikation på det lokala nätverket:
- Fyra stycken Windows 10-klienter, varav en är stationär och ethernetansluten och övriga tre är Wi-Fi-anslutna bärbara. Det är den stationära datorn som inte fungerar fullt ut. Samtliga med Norton Internet Security.
- Två stycken QNAP-servrar.
- Windows Workgroup men ej Homegroup.
Problembeskrivning:
Från en dag fullt fungerande dator till nästa dag, då den startade med att installera uppdateringar, varpå Utforskaren under Nätverk var tom med undantag från mediaservrar, router etcetera. Vare sig egen dator, övriga tre bärbara eller de två servrarna var synliga.
Efter mycket felsökningsarbete som inkluderade uppdatering av nätverksadapter blev samtliga Windows-klienter synliga under Nätverk i Utforskaren, men servrarna visade sig inte.
De tre bärbara kunde expanderas medan den felande datorn inte lät sig expanderas och felkod visade sig. Servrarnas Shares kunde dock mappas manuellt med IP-adress (men inte med enhetsnamn).
Det leder mig till att tro att något protokoll som hanterar namnuppslagning saknas/slutat fungera och där står jag nu.
Vore tacksam om tips om hur jag kan gå vidare i felsökningen.
Mats
Svar
Nätverk kan vara knepiga. I version 1709 av Windows (Fall Creators Update) har Microsoft tagit bort den 30 år gamla och osäkra version 1 av SMB-protokollet (Server Message Block), vilket skulle kunna ställa till med problem. Men enligt uppgift ska det lämnas kvar vid en uppdatering, så om du inte har gjort en ren installation borde det inte vara orsaken.
Du kan kolla vilken version dina datorer använder genom att starta Powershell med administratörsbehörighet och skriva
get-smbconnection
Du kan också testa om SMB1 är igång genom att öppna Kommandotolken med administratörsbehörighet och skriva
net view
Om detta leder till ett felmeddelande körs inte SMB1. Du kan slå på det genom att gå till Kontrollpanelen, öppna ”Program och funktioner” och välja ”Aktivera eller inaktivera Windows-funktioner” till vänster. En bit ned hittar du ”Stöd för SMB 1.0” och kan aktivera det.
Problemet kan också ha att göra med vilken enhet i ditt nätverk som är ”master browser”
Observera dock att det är mycket osäkert att använda. Men är det avstängt kan du ju slå på det tillfälligt för att avgöra om det löser ditt nätverkskrångel.
Problemet kan också ha att göra med vilken enhet i ditt nätverk som är ”master browser” eller om flera enheter försöker sköta den uppgiften. I ett nätverk utan domänserver är det master browsern som håller reda på vilka enheter som är anslutna till nätverket, enkelt uttryckt genom att emellanåt skicka ut frågor.
Om flera enheter vill vara master browser sker en ”omröstning”. Anslutna enheter enas helt enkelt om vem som ska bestämma över nätverket. Om aktuell master browser stängs av konfererar kvarvarande enheter på nytt och utser en ny.
Det här kan ibland leda till underligheter och att nätverksenheter inte visas. Du kan avgöra vilken enhet i ditt nätverk som är master browser med följande metod. Öppna Kommandotolken med administratörsbehörighet och använd något av kommandona
nbtstat -a namn
eller
nbtstat -A IP-adress
för samtliga enheter i nätverket. För någon av enheterna kommer du att hitta _MSBROWSE_ i resultatet. Detta är master browsern. Hos mig är det min router. I ditt fall vore nog det bästa att någon av QNAP-enheterna är master browser. Du kan inte tvinga fram det på något enkelt sätt, men du kan åtminstone se till att enheten är med i omröstningen genom att slå på möjligheten.
Det ska gå att göra i inställningarna, under Control Panel > Network Services > Win/Mac/NFS > Advanced Options. Där kan du också aktivera SMB 3.0.
Läs även vad Microsoft skriver om SMB: https://support.microsoft.com/en-gb/help/4034314/smbv1-is-not-installed-windows-10-and-windows-server-version-1709
4 kommentarer
Hej, jag har Windows 10 Pro version 1803, hade samma problem med att jag inte kunde se äldre enheter på mitt nätverk, men jag gick in i ”Aktivera eller inaktivera Windows-funktioner” där klickade jag i ”Stöd för SMB 1.0/CIFS-fildelning” både klient och server, sedan ser jag och kan utforska/ansluta äldre enheter.
Stort tack för SMB-hjälpen Anders! =)
Fungerade. Nu får jag upp min Netgear NAS på huvuddatorn med Win 10
”Stöd för SMB 1.0/CIFS-fildelning” både klient och server, sedan ser jag och kan utforska/ansluta äldre enheter.. var lösningen
Tack för hjälpen Anders Reuterswärd
Jag tackar också för tipset som jag just blev hjälpt av